Canada-Based Aerospace Company Establishing U.S. HQ in Georgia
Area Development Online News Desk (11/18/2009)
Star Navigation Systems Group Ltd., a Canada-headquartered aerospace company, will invest $1 million to establish its U.S. headquarters in Atlanta, Georgia, according to the Georgia governor's office. The company, which plans to create 20 new jobs over the next three years, produces in-flight monitoring systems; the Georgia facility will target commercial and defense applications for its STAR-ISMS product. "Georgia is ideally situated to help us market STAR-ISMS to our U.S., Central, and South American markets, which are easily accessible through Hartsfield Atlanta Airport," says Viraf Kapadia, Star Navigation's chair and CEO. "I look forward to building on the great relationship we've established with the Georgia business community as our company continues to build its presence here." No information was released regarding financial incentives.
